Job details:
- Manages the program to align with evolving Critical Application Recovery policy, audit requirements, compliance obligations, and business needs and objectives. Establish the program metrics and standards, develop plans to improve the success measures. Identifies and remediates recovery gaps noted during tabletop exercises or live system recovery tests.
- Plan, build, run and manage enterprise-wide IT DR for JLL, including DR strategies, plan development, plan exercising, and manage related IT budgets (capital and operational), annual program agendas and recovery improvement metrics.
- Oversee the design, execution and continuous improvement of DR plans through rigorous exercising. Manage the execution and completion of all DR test activities.
- The person who fills this position will be expected to collaborate with business continuity management (BCM), business unit management, external business partners and key IT staff members to plan, direct, control and maintain effective DR plan testing.
- Manage the creation of program status communications to internal management (e.g., board of directors, the audit committee, BCM steering committee and business unit management) and external stakeholders (including regulators, auditors and customers) regarding the status of the DR program, including annual reporting, audit report responses and customer requests.
- Ensures and tracks the delivery of Critical System Recovery Program awareness and education, coordinating as needed with the System Recovery Coordinators around the world. Provides subject matter expertise to internal customers and external clients.
- Manages the annual review process for the Critical Infrastructure and Business System Recovery Plans. Maintains the Critical System Recovery repository that includes the most recent copies of all the Critical Infrastructure and Business System Recovery Plans.
- Manages execution of live system recovery tests, coordinating recovery resources, scheduling test events, developing and managing the recovery test tasks, monitoring results, collecting artifacts, creating and disseminating test reports, and managing remediation plans to close discovered gaps if required.
- Manages client information requests throughout the full lifecycle of client acquisition and ongoing service delivery. Participates in compliance audits (SOC2, ISO, or client) as the continuity and resiliency SME.
